Wejsuny is a small village in the Powiat of Pisz in the Warmian-Masurian Voivodeship and belongs to southeastern Masuria. The place is less of a center with a packed program than a quiet starting point for travelers who want to get to know the rural side of this region, rich in water and forests.

A small historical reference in the village

A village church, dated to 1910, is part of the local identity. It is not a reason to describe Wejsuny as a major historical excursion destination, but it does give the small place a visible historical reference. Arrival and orientation in the wider area

The transport reference for Wejsuny includes the road in the Ruciane-Nida area or the DK 58 as well as the Olsztyn–Pisz railway line. This does not allow any conclusion about a current timetable or a specific transport connection.
